Saint Regis Mohawk Tribe Partridge House is an inpatient addiction program serving Native American men and women struggling with alcohol and drug addiction. This 56-day program offers a specialized focus on the specific challenges faced by Native communities, providing a safe and supportive environment for early recovery and personal growth. The program uses a holistic, trauma-informed, and spiritually focused approach. Participants receive individual counseling, group therapy, educational lectures, and gender-specific support groups. Traditional teachings and spiritual ceremonies are incorporated into the program to support healing, assist clients in developing coping skills, and provide a foundation for 12-Step recovery. Residents live in a secure setting designed to promote healing and self-empowerment. The program encourages family involvement through weekly education groups and supports each participant’s journey of hope, wellness, and growth through a non-judgmental team approach focused on self-discovery and lasting sobriety.
